This form serves as a notice of default to the mortgagor for payments that are past due. The default notice states that while the property is in foreclosure, the mortgagor is still responsible for paying other obligations required by the note and the deed of trust. If the mortgagor fails to make future payments on the loan or other financial obligations, the beneficiary or the mortgagee may insist that he/she do so in order to reinstate the account into good standing. The form also emphasizes that the mortgagor could lose his/her rights in the property if prompt action is not taken.

There are different types of Vallejo California Notice of Default and Election to Sell Under Deed of Trust that homeowners should be aware of: 1. Preliminary Notice of Default: This is the initial notice sent to the homeowner after they have missed a certain number of consecutive mortgage payments. It informs them of the lender's intention to begin foreclosure proceedings if the outstanding payments are not made within a specific timeframe. 2. Notice of Default: If the homeowner fails to bring the mortgage payments up to date within the specified timeframe mentioned in the preliminary notice, the lender will send a Notice of Default. This notice formally states that the borrower is in default and provides them with a specific amount of time to cure the default by paying the outstanding balance. 3. Notice of Election to Sell Under Deed of Trust: If the homeowner does not cure the default within the given time frame, the lender may proceed with filing a Notice of Election to Sell Under Deed of Trust. This notice informs the homeowner that the property will be sold at a public auction to recoup the outstanding balance on their mortgage loan. It is essential for homeowners in Vallejo, California, who have received a Notice of Default and Election to Sell Under Deed of Trust to seek legal advice promptly to understand their rights and explore options such as loan modification or foreclosure alternatives. Failing to take appropriate action may result in the loss of their property through foreclosure.

After you've received a Notice of Default, you have 3 months in which to attempt to get your loan current. As mentioned above, that means paying all back payments, interest, fees, property taxes, and insurance. After 3 months, the bank can officially set a date for the auction of your home.

If real property is utilized to secure a loan, it is usually achieved by executing a mortgage or, in California, a Deed of Trust. A mortgage is a document that allows the creditor, who is unpaid, to proceed to court to force the sale of the property to pay off the debt.

In CA a Notice of Default does not expire. The Notice of Default would be active until a Notice of Rescission or a Reconveyance is recorded on the loan in question.
